Refrigerator Problems
LG refrigerators, particularly their French door and side-by-side models, are a popular choice. Common issues include:
Insufficient cooling or freezing: This could be due to a faulty compressor, a defrost system problem, or issues with the evaporator fan.
Water leakage: Leaks can stem from clogged defrost drains, damaged water inlet valves, or faulty water line connections.
Ice maker not producing ice: Problems with the water supply, temperature issues, or a malfunctioning ice maker mechanism itself can cause this.
Unusual noises: Whirring, humming, or rattling sounds often indicate a problem with the fan motor, compressor, or condenser coils needing cleaning.
Washing Machine Malfunctions
LG’s innovative washing machines, including their popular front-load and top-load models, can encounter problems such as:
Not draining or spinning: This often points to a clogged drain pump filter, a malfunctioning drain pump, or a faulty lid switch.
Excessive vibration or noise during cycles: Unbalanced loads are a common culprit, but drum bearing issues or faulty suspension rods can also be the cause.
Error codes displayed on the panel: Technicians can diagnose these codes to pinpoint the exact problem, which might involve motor issues, water level sensor problems, or control board malfunctions.
Leaks during operation: Door seal damage, loose hoses, or a compromised tub can lead to leaks.
Oven and Range Issues
LG ovens and ranges, whether electric or gas, are central to many kitchens. Common repair needs include:
Uneven cooking or heating: This could signify a faulty heating element, a malfunctioning bake or broil igniter, or thermostat calibration issues.
Self-cleaning function not working: Problems with the heating element, lock mechanism, or control board can prevent the self-cleaning cycle from operating.
Burner not igniting (gas ranges): Issues with the igniter, gas valve, or gas supply line need professional attention.
Control panel malfunctions: Touchpads or digital displays that are unresponsive or display incorrect information often require control board replacement.

Hard Water Impact on Appliances in Arlington Heights
Water in the Arlington Heights area tests at approximately 296 mg/L (classified as "very hard"). Hard water causes calcium and magnesium scale to build up inside washing machines, dishwashers, and water-using appliances — reducing efficiency and shortening component life. Is it worth repairing a LG Appliance Repair or should I replace it?
A general rule: if the repair cost exceeds 50% of a new appliance's price, and the appliance is over 8–10 years old, replacement is often the better value. Appliances approaching 15 years have a higher risk of secondary failures shortly after a primary repair.

Illinois Electricity Rates & LG Appliance Repair Value
At Illinois's average residential rate of 17.69¢/kWh (EIA, 2025), the repair-vs-replace math turns on how much energy an appliance uses: an aging always-on refrigerator (~150 kWh/mo) costs ~$27/month versus ~$8 for an efficient model, while intermittent appliances (ovens, washers) are driven more by repair cost than running cost. A skilled repair that restores efficiency on a newer unit is almost always the better outcome.
